Paebbl is an industrial resilience company turning captured CO₂ into carbon-storing building materials. We accelerate the natural process of CO₂ mineralisation — in which CO₂ reacts with minerals to form stable carbonates from thousands of years — to a matter of hours, producing a carbon-negative powder that can replace conventional, heavily emitting cementitious materials. Having switched on the world's first continuous CO₂ mineralisation demonstration plant, we are now scaling from startup execution into structured industrial operations.
